Synopsis: The Mobile Investigative Unit (or "MIU") of the Tokyo Metropolitan Police Department attempts to solve cases within 24 hours.
Detective Shima Kazumi is selected as a new member of MIU. He is intelligent, with excellent observation and communication skills. He is unable to find a partner in MIU and is ordered to partner with Ibuki Ai, who works at a police substation. Ibuki applied for MIU, but he failed. He is in excellent physical condition, but he lacks knowledge and experience as a detective.
Genre: Cop/Crime, Mystery, Bromance

@catatonicrainbow recommended this Japanese Police Procedural to get through the days when I don't have any BLs to watch (because all the fricking shows are on the weekend) and believe me I was initially taken aback by the first episode. Except for Japanese BLs and anime I haven't watched much else from Japan, so it took me some time to get used to the conversation style, humor and characters. But after that first episode it was such a fun and beautiful ride. With just 11 episodes, it dives deep into various types of cases. I thought it would be the same as other police shows I've seen, but there was definitely something very different in this show. The basic premise was the same, but the way they tackled the cases, the passion and heart behind being a detective, the kind of stories they explored were so different. I loved the depth and growth of each character in this show. Where many shows stick to black and white, they gave us morally grey and there doesn't have to be a big reason for that.
Ayano Go as Ibuki Ai and Hoshino Gen as Shima Kazumi were wonderful as partners and carried the show really well. The supporting cast deserves a round of applause because they exceeded my expectations.
If you want something different and new from a police procedural, give this show a chance.

Native titles: S(エス)-最後の警官; S-最後の警官- 奪還 RECOVERY OF OUR FUTURE
Synopsis: To fight extreme crimes like terrorism, kidnappings, etc. three 'S' groups were formed: SAT, SIT and the newly formed NPS. Unlike SAT, who only focus on saving the hostages' lives and prioritize public safety over the lives of the criminals, NPS's main goal is to arrest the criminal alive.
Kamikura Ichigo is a former boxer and is the main fighter of NPS. His principle is not to let anyone die no matter what and the only weapon he uses is his fists. Iori Soga is the sniper of SAT, and he thinks criminals deserve death and will not hesitate to kill. Their different views often cause conflicts, but the looming threat of dangerous terrorists necessitate the two teams to work closely together.
